How to Register at Betbus South Africa
Step-by-Step Sign Up Guide | 3 Minutes | Claim R5,000 Bonus
Create your Betbus account and start betting on sports, slots & Aviator
⚡ Quick Facts: Betbus Registration
- Time Required: 2-3 minutes
- Minimum Age: 18 years (SA ID required)
- Minimum Deposit: R100
- Welcome Bonus: 100% Sports up to R5,000 or 120% Casino up to R6,000
- FICA Required: Yes, before claiming bonuses or withdrawing
✅ Licensed by: Mpumalanga Economic Regulator (9-2-1-09797)
Want to join Betbus? This guide walks you through the complete Betbus registration process step-by-step. Whether you want to bet on sports, play slots, or try crash games like Aviator, you’ll need to create an account first.
Betbus is owned by AI Sports (Pty) Ltd and fully licensed in South Africa. The sign-up process takes about 2-3 minutes, but you’ll also need to complete FICA verification before you can claim bonuses or withdraw winnings.
📋 What’s in This Guide
📝 Betbus Registration Requirements
Before you start the Betbus sign-up process, make sure you have the following ready:
✅ What You’ll Need
- South African ID Number – 13-digit ID number (must be 18+)
- Mobile Phone – For SMS verification
- Email Address – Valid email for account notifications
- Residential Address – Your current SA address
- For FICA: Clear photo of your SA ID document
- For FICA: Proof of address (utility bill, bank statement – less than 3 months old)
⚠️ Important: Age Restriction
You must be 18 years or older to register at Betbus. Your age will be verified using your SA ID number. Attempting to register if underage is illegal under South African gambling law.
📲 How to Register at Betbus: Step-by-Step
Follow these steps to create your Betbus account:
Step 1: Visit the Betbus Website
Go to Betbus.co.za using your browser or download the Betbus app. Look for the “Join Now” or “Register” button in the top right corner of the screen.
💡 Tip: Use our link to ensure you qualify for the welcome bonus.
Step 2: Enter Your Login Details
Create your account credentials:
- Username: Choose a unique username (letters and numbers only)
- Password: Create a strong password (min 8 characters, include numbers)
- Confirm Password: Re-enter your password
💡 Tip: Write down your username – you’ll need it to log in.
Step 3: Provide Personal Information
Enter your personal details exactly as they appear on your ID:
- First Name: As per your ID document
- Last Name: As per your ID document
- Email Address: Valid email for notifications
- Mobile Number: SA cellphone number (for SMS verification)
⚠️ Important: Use your real details – they must match your FICA documents.
Step 4: Enter Your SA ID Number
Enter your 13-digit South African ID number. This is used to:
- Verify you are 18 years or older
- Confirm your identity
- Comply with SA gambling regulations
Note: Your date of birth will be automatically extracted from your ID number.
Step 5: Add Your Address
Enter your current residential address in South Africa:
- Street Address: House/unit number and street name
- Suburb: Your suburb or area
- City: Your city or town
- Province: Select from dropdown
- Postal Code: Your area’s postal code
Step 6: Accept Terms & Create Account
Review and accept the terms:
- ✅ Read and accept the Terms and Conditions
- ✅ Confirm you are 18 years or older
- ✅ Agree to the Privacy Policy
- 📧 Optionally subscribe to promotional emails
Click “Create Account” or “Register” to proceed.
Step 7: Verify Your Mobile Number
Betbus will send an SMS with a verification code (OTP) to your mobile number:
- Check your phone for the SMS
- Enter the 4-6 digit code on the website
- Click “Verify” to confirm
💡 Tip: If you don’t receive the SMS within 2 minutes, click “Resend Code”.
✅ Registration Complete!
Your Betbus account is now created. However, to claim bonuses and make withdrawals, you’ll need to complete FICA verification – see the next section.
🔐 Betbus FICA Verification Guide
FICA (Financial Intelligence Centre Act) verification is required by South African law for all licensed betting sites. You must complete FICA before you can:
- Claim any welcome bonus
- Withdraw winnings from your account
- Access certain account features
📄 Documents Required for FICA
- Proof of Identity: Clear photo/scan of your South African ID (both sides) or valid passport
- Proof of Address: Recent document (less than 3 months old) showing your name and address – utility bill, bank statement, or municipal account
File formats accepted: JPG, PNG, PDF (max 5MB per file)
How to Complete FICA at Betbus
- Log in to your Betbus account
- Go to Account Settings or Profile
- Find the Verification or FICA section
- Upload a clear photo of your SA ID (front and back)
- Upload your proof of address document
- Submit and wait for verification (usually 24-48 hours)
💡 Tips for Faster FICA Approval
- Ensure all four corners of your ID are visible
- Take photos in good lighting – no glare or shadows
- Make sure all text is clearly readable
- Proof of address must show your full name and current address
- Documents must not be expired
💰 Making Your First Deposit
After registering and completing FICA, you’re ready to deposit. The minimum deposit at Betbus is R100.
| Deposit Method | Processing Time | Fees |
|---|---|---|
| Ozow (Instant EFT) | Instant | Free |
| Visa / Mastercard | Instant | Free |
| OTT Voucher | Instant | Free |
| 1Voucher / Blu Voucher | Instant | Free |
| EasyPay | Instant | Free |
🎁 Claiming Your Betbus Welcome Bonus
New players can choose between two welcome bonus options. You can only claim one – choose based on whether you prefer sports betting or casino games.
⚽ Sports Bonus: 100% up to R5,000
- Match: 100% of your first deposit
- Maximum: R5,000 bonus
- Wagering: 5x (deposit + bonus) at odds 2.0+
- Time Limit: 7 days
- Min Deposit: R100
- Min Bet: R50 per qualifying bet
🎰 Casino Bonus: 120% up to R6,000
- Match: 120% of your first deposit
- Maximum: R6,000 bonus
- Wagering: 35x (deposit + bonus)
- Time Limit: 30 days
- Eligible Games: Gates of Olympus, Cash Pig, specified slots
- Min Deposit: R100
⚠️ Important Bonus Rules
- FICA must be completed before you can claim any bonus
- You can only claim ONE welcome bonus (sports OR casino)
- Withdrawing before meeting wagering requirements forfeits the bonus
- One bonus per person/household/IP address
🔧 Troubleshooting Common Registration Issues
“Username already exists”
Someone else has already taken that username. Try adding numbers to make it unique, e.g., JohnSmith123 or John_SA2026.
“Invalid ID number”
Double-check you’ve entered all 13 digits correctly. Make sure there are no spaces. Your ID must indicate you are 18 or older.
“SMS verification code not received”
Wait 2-3 minutes, then click “Resend Code”. Ensure your phone number is correct and has signal. Check your SMS inbox (not WhatsApp).
“Account already exists with this ID”
You may have registered before. Try the “Forgot Password” option to recover your existing account. Contact Betbus support at support@betbus.co.za if you need help.
“FICA documents rejected”
Common reasons: blurry photos, glare on ID, address document older than 3 months, or name doesn’t match exactly. Retake clear photos and resubmit.
❓ Frequently Asked Questions
How long does Betbus registration take?
The basic registration takes 2-3 minutes. FICA verification adds another 24-48 hours for document review. Complete FICA immediately to avoid delays when you want to withdraw.
Is Betbus registration free?
Yes, creating a Betbus account is completely free. You only need money when you want to make a deposit and start betting. The minimum deposit is R100.
Can I register on the Betbus mobile app?
Yes, you can register directly in the Betbus app. Download the Android APK from the Betbus website or get the iOS app from the App Store (4.0/5 rating). The registration process is the same as on the website.
Why do I need to complete FICA?
FICA verification is required by South African law under the Financial Intelligence Centre Act. All licensed bookmakers must verify customer identities to prevent fraud, money laundering, and underage gambling.
Can I have multiple Betbus accounts?
No. Betbus only allows one account per person, household, and IP address. Creating multiple accounts violates their terms and can result in all accounts being closed and funds forfeited.
What if I forget my Betbus login details?
Click “Forgot Password” on the login page. Enter your registered email or phone number to receive a password reset link. If you’ve forgotten your username, contact Betbus support at support@betbus.co.za.
📚 Related Betbus Guides
- Betbus Review – Full review of the platform
- AI Sports (Pty) Ltd – About the company behind Betbus
- FICA Verification Guide – Understanding account verification
- Mpumalanga Economic Regulator – About the licensing authority
Ready to Join Betbus?
✅ 2-Minute Registration | ✅ R5,000 Welcome Bonus | ✅ Instant Deposits | ✅ Licensed & Safe
18+ Only. Betbus is operated by AI Sports (Pty) Ltd and licensed by the Mpumalanga Economic Regulator (9-2-1-09797). Gambling can be addictive and harmful if not controlled. Winners know when to stop. For help, contact South African Responsible Gambling Foundation: 0800 006 008 or WhatsApp 076 675 0710.
Disclaimer: This guide was last updated January 2026. Registration processes and bonus terms may change. Always verify current details on the official Betbus website.
Affiliate Disclosure: iBets.co.za may receive commission through affiliate links, but this does not influence our guides and tutorials.
Licensing: AI Sports (Pty) Ltd. Licensed by Mpumalanga Economic Regulator (9-2-1-09797). 18+. Winners know when to stop.





